How to fill out the WV Election Worker Report

  1. 1.
    To access the West Virginia Paid Election Workers Report, visit pdfFiller's website and use the search function to find the form.
  2. 2.
    After opening the form, begin by filling in the 'County Name of Candidate or Committee Hiring' at the top of the document.
  3. 3.
    Next, complete the fields for 'Election Worker's Name' and 'Res. Address', ensuring all information is accurate and up-to-date.
  4. 4.
    Enter the 'City State Zip' for the worker along with the total days worked and the agreed upon pay rate in the designated fields.
  5. 5.
    If applicable, add details regarding the candidate(s) supported and any additional information such as 'TIME', 'DATE', and 'MILEAGE' in the provided sections.
  6. 6.
    Make sure to provide a description of the work performed under the 'DESC' field to clearly outline the nature of the election work.
  7. 7.
    Once all fields are entered, review the completed form carefully, checking for any errors or missing information.
  8. 8.
    At the end of the form, locate the 'OATH AND ACKNOWLEDGEMENT' section, and ensure the election campaign worker signs the document.
  9. 9.
    After reviewing, you can save the completed form directly in pdfFiller. Download it in your preferred format, or use the submission options provided.
  10. 10.
    If you're submitting the form, follow the instructions on how to submit electronically or via mail to the appropriate candidate or committee.

This report is for individuals working temporarily in election campaigns in West Virginia. Eligible workers include those hired by candidates, political committees, or political action committees.
While the specific deadline isn't provided, it's essential to submit the report before the payment to the worker can occur. To ensure timely payment, submit it as soon as possible after the work is completed.
You can submit the report via pdfFiller after completing it. Alternatively, it can be printed and mailed to the candidate or committee if required.
Generally, supporting documents are not needed unless specifically requested by the candidate or committee. Ensure that all fields on the form are completed accurately.
Ensure all entries are accurate, particularly the worker's name and pay details. Omitting the signature or providing incorrect information can lead to delays in processing.
Processing times can vary based on the candidate or committee's review process. It's recommended to submit the report early to avoid payment delays.
If changes are needed after submission, contact the candidate or committee directly for guidance on how to amend the submitted information.
